The winner of the U.S. Open golf tournament in 2025 will earn $4.3 million as part of a $21.5 million purse, according to the PGA Tour.
On Wednesday, the U.S. Golf Association announced that the purse for the 2025 U.S. Open at Oakmont Country Club would remain $21.5 million with the winner taking home $4.3 million. It's the largest prize in professional golf outside of the PGA Tour's Players Championship and Tour Championship,
